Eden Villas was a perfectly pleasant stay for our family. The 2 bed villa was perfect for our needs and very spacious. We were all inclusive but there was a good kitchen should you wish to cook. The main pool was refreshing although a little small for the size of resort. It got very busy. Very much aimed at families but definitely for those 10 and under. Not much, if anything for teens. Did have to get up relatively early to get a sunbed. They say they can only be saved for 30 mins max but I only saw towels removed once (that I saw). Food and drink are as expected at this level of All Inclusive - whilst different dishes are on offer and in plentiful supply, it all felt very repetitive after a few days. Nice a la.carte that you can book once (but no choice, set menu). Shuttle bus to beach is OK, but the Eden area is a bit of a trek from drop off and the sea there is very seaweedy. Better to go to the Old Town and go to the beach there. Shuttle bus is very much needed as resort is far from anything really. Am sure you could walk but tough in August heat. Taxis are cheap though. But don't expect to pop out to a local bar. Onsite shop is limited and open 9-6. Entertainment was enthusiastic - not much for teens as I say. All in all a perfectly decent holiday. Just a few things to be aware of surrounding location etc.

Our accommodation was very nice, spacious, well equipped, and very clean. The resort overall is very family-focused, so there is a lot of noise around the family pool and the AquaPlay areas, but there are quiet areas further away, including around the adults pool. Staff were all very friendly and very helpful. Some areas, such as the toddlers' play area, are a bit tired looking and could do with a bit of attention and better equipment. While I was playing with my grandson in the family pool, I badly cut my foot on a grating on the bottom: I reported this to a member of staff, but I don't know whether anything was done about it. There are limited dining facilities, considering that most people are on an all-inclusive deal, but there is a reasonable selection of food on offer and the menu appears to vary from day to day. For those paying, breakfast is good value, but dinner is on the expensive side. An occasional shuttle bus is available to go into town, but taxis are inexpensive and easily available. It is only a few minutes run into town, where there are numerous restaurants and lovely beaches.
